Reverse description A stylized grape bunch suspended from a curving vine tendril occupies the central field, rendered in the compact, schematic manner typical of Solian civic coinage. The magistrate's monogram HP appears in the upper left field. The ethnic legend ΣOΛEΩN is disposed vertically along the right field, identifying the issuing city of Soloi in Greek characters. The overall composition is balanced within the irregular flan, consistent with hammered technique of the period.
